This error may be caused by changing the location of your Windows temp file(s) to somewhere other than the C partition. Typically Windows uses the C drive for temporary extraction of files but some applications may change this to a location other than the C drive.

Please try the following for Windows 2000:

1) Right-click My Computer > Properties > Advanced

2) Locate and reset the location of Temp/tmp folders to the C drive

3) Reboot

Please try the install again.

For other versions of Windows including XP, to locate the the location of the Temp directory click on Start > Run and type: %temp% and press OK. If the root location is not the C drive then contact technical support.
